| Background information: |
Also known as a pro-inflammatory agent, As such, PLAP has been found in inflamed tissues and synovial fluid from patients with rheumatoid arthritis, The formation of PLAP can be stimulated by IL-1 beta and TNF-alpha, activates PLA2 (phospholipase A2 enzyme) and is an important mediator of eicosanoid generation, it is believed to play an important role in the regulation of inflammatory diseases, Phospholipase A2 activator protein (PLAP) |
